Output cd0f6ed3de384ca683a41764a91f72aa49263acc58b40885492b140e9e4f0534:7

value
43837061
script pubkey
OP_0 OP_PUSHBYTES_20 2ec08bd106859418f59a775fa19abab12e371d5a
address
bc1q9mqgh5gxsk2p3av6wa06rx46kyhrw826utgzkc
transaction
cd0f6ed3de384ca683a41764a91f72aa49263acc58b40885492b140e9e4f0534
spent
true